Armstrong makes debut! Heath impresses for Accrington! Clean Sheet for Barnsley!

Harrison Armstrong Preston Debut

Championship:

Harrison Armstrong- Preston North End- 9th out of 24

Armstrong made his debut for Preston on Saturday, appearing as a 62nd minute substitute in a 2-2 home draw with Middlesbrough.

The midfielder replaced Alfie Devine with the hosts leading 1-0, however The Lilywhites failed to see the game out, conceding a last-gasp equaliser to the league leaders.

Paul Heckingbottom’s side travel to Armstrong’s former club Derby County next.

 

League One:

Francis Okoronkwo- Lincoln City- 7th out of 24

Okoronkwo played 78 minutes of Lincoln’s 1-0 away win at Burton Albion, as The Imps extended their unbeaten run to nine games.

The forward is back in action on Saturday, as Sincil Bank plays host to Luton Town.

 

Martin Sherif- Rotherham United- 18th out of 24

Sherif missed Rotherham’s 2-1 defeat at AFC Wimbledon due to injury, as The Millers’ poor form continued.

Matt Hamshaw’s side are at home to Stockport County next.

 

Tyler Onyango- Stockport County- 10th out of 24

Onyango started Stockport’s disappointing draw with Cardiff City, the defender featuring for 82 minutes before being substituted with The Hatters leading 1-0.

Yousef Salech equalised in the 97th minute for Cardiff to deny County a vital three points.

The 22-year-old returns to action at Rotherham United on Saturday.

 

League Two:

Isaac Heath- Accrington Stanley- 20th out of 24

Heath was instrumental in Accrington’s first win of the season, as The Reds lifted themselves off the foot of the table with a 1-0 home win over Colchester United.

Supporters took to social media to praise the performance of the loanee, who has made an instant impact in Lancashire since his deadline day move.

John Doolan’s side travel to MK Dons next.

 

National League North:

Fraser Barnsley- Marine- 18th out of 24

Barnsley recorded a clean sheet in his senior debut as Marine triumphed 2-0 away to Newcastle Blue Star.

The 20-year-old is at home to King’s Lynn Town on Saturday.
